HUD Question
 
2016 CT6 Heads Up Display works well, but I have one question. On the left hand side of the display is a curved bar with a pointer, that I have yet seen move. This is directly below the lane keeper display, cruise control display and vehicle detected ahead display. When you engage cruise control, the speed it is set at appears right below this bar and above rpm display. I have looked everywhere and have found nothing about this curved bar. Does anyone know? They didn't know at dealership.

Looked at mine yesterday. That symbol on the HUD will show anytime your cruise control is activated (turned on), whether it is engaged or not. It will mimic the cruise control set indicator on the speedometer. When turned on and not engaged, the speedometer cruise indicator is shown, but greyed out. When activated, speedo one will show in color and the HUD one will show the set speed below the symbol.
To make both go away, just turn off the cruise control.
